Headquartered in Ottawa, Canada, Thermal Energy International Inc. was established in 1991. The company specializes in the design, engineering, and provision of environmental control products, sophisticated heat recovery systems, and effective condensate return solutions. Its operations extend across North America, Europe, and international markets. The firm offers a wide array of products, including GEM steam traps; FLU-ACE, a direct-contact condensing heat recovery system specifically engineered to reclaim wasted heat from boiler flue gas exhaust; DRY-REX, a low-temperature biomass drying system; various indirect contact heat recovery apparatus; boiler economizers sold under the HeatSponge brand; both wet and dry steam accumulators; electricity co-generation technologies; comprehensive thermal energy packages; and water treatment offerings. Thermal Energy International Inc. caters to numerous sectors, such as food and beverage, pulp and paper, hospitals, pharmaceuticals, chemicals and petrochemicals, among other industrial clients.
